This is a Request for Information (RFI) only issued for conducting market research. Accordingly, this RFI constitutes neither a Request for Quote (RFQ) nor a guarantee that one will be issued by the Government in the future; furthermore, it does not commit the Government to contract for any services described herein. VA, Office of Information & Technology (OIT), Infrastructure Operations (IO), has a requirement to modernize and replace specified International Business Machines (IBM) mainframe platforms (Central Processing Unit (CPU) complexes) and mainframe virtual tape system (VTS) located at the Austin Information Technology Center and the disaster recovery CPU complex at Philadelphia Information Technology Center. This project will provide for on demand scaling of the mainframe CPU complexes and mainframe virtual tape system and will include regular hardware upgrades/refresh and maintenance for all associated equipment over the life of the agreement. The Government is pursuing an on-premise Capacity Services Model (not a lease) solution. The Contractor will enable VA to use the mainframe CPU complex and mainframe VTS hardware and associated services for each of the identified sites. The attached draft Performance Work Statement, Price Schedule, Attachment A - Price Spreadsheet and Cover Page contain additional information concerning this effort.
